#bd1549 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d1549 is composed of 74.1% red, 8.2%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.9%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 341.4 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 41.2%. #bd1549 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a92 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#bd1549 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bd1549 has RGB values of R:189, G:21,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.61,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12391753.

Hex triplet bd1549 #bd1549
RGB Decimal 189, 21, 73 rgb(189,21,73)
RGB Percent 74.1, 8.2, 28.6 rgb(74.1%,8.2%,28.6%)
CMYK 0, 89, 61, 26
HSL 341.4°, 80, 41.2 hsl(341.4,80%,41.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 341.4°, 88.9, 74.1
Web Safe cc0033 #cc0033
CIE-LAB 40.959, 63.598, 16.566
XYZ 22.458, 11.839, 7.406
xyY 0.539, 0.284, 11.839
CIE-LCH 40.959, 65.72, 14.6
CIE-LUV 40.959, 109.868, 5.89
Hunter-Lab 34.408, 56.294, 11.324
Binary 10111101, 00010101, 01001001

Shades and Tints of #bd1549

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0105 is the darkest color, while #fefaf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d1549

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6668 is the less saturated color, while #cd0543 is the most saturated one.
